Tim, I think a set of bias ply red lines with either Cragars or Torque Thrusts would look killer on a Chevelle.. I really like the bias ply look but some guys prefer radials.. You can pick up Firestone Wide Ovals for a reasonable price. Summit & Jegs sells them now or you can even check ebay. Sometimes it is much cheaper than going through Coker direct..

I have a set of Cragar SS wheels with Firestone Wide oval RSWL tires for my 70 Nova. It really changes the look from the bias ply white stripe tires and color coded wheels with the poverty caps!! It's nice to change the look periodically.....
